Gerald McRaney (1947 - )
Film Deaths
- Women and Bloody Terror (His Wife's Habit) (1969) [Terrance Bradford]: Killed in a car crash while being chased by Michael Anthony and Marcus J. Grapes.
- The A-Team (2010) [General Russell Morrison]: Killed in an explosion after Patrick Wilson calls in an airstrike in an attempt to kill Bradley Cooper, Sharlto Copley, Quinton "Rampage" Jackson, and Liam Neeson. (Thanks to Tommy)
TV Deaths
- Gunsmoke: Hard Labor (1975) [Pete Murphy]: Shot to death in a shoot-out with James Arness.
- Mannix: Edge of the Web (1975) [Prof. Jim Duncan]: Shot to death (off-screen) by Joshua Bryant, trying to make it look like suicide. His body is shown when the police investigate.
- Jericho: Why We Fight (2007) [Johnston Green]: Mortally wounded in a shoot-out when the neighboring town of New Bern attacks the town of Jericho. He dies later in Brad Beyer's farmhouse with his sons (Skeet Ulrich and Kenneth Mitchell) at his side.
- Longmire: High Noon (2015) [Barlow Connally] Commits suicide by stabbing himself twice in the gut after being shot in the stomach by & dragged by Robert Taylor (VII)
